Added: Bayang telemetry
Changed telemetry configuration and validation for AFHDS2A and HUBSAN Added default Bayang telemetry from Silverxxx: - Option=1 to activate telemetry (option=0 -> standard Bayang protocol) - Value returned to the TX: RX RSSI, TX RSSI, A1=uncompensated battery voltage, A2=compensated battery voltage
